I'm actually not racing Tuesday (sorry, just updated my races). However, the good news is that in my achilles rehab, I started back to running again last week, and I'm picking my cycling back up as well (as seen for those in the TrainerRoad group).

My PT is going well, and is doing solid work in building up the tendon and the stabilizers in my right ankle.  I believe I'll be back to regular running soon, after losing three months out of the year.  I think the reality is that I need to do some regular strength training, because that is what PT has essentially been the last two times for me.  I also hope to do some running form tweaking while my distance is super short, and shift my footstrike forward a bit, along with moving my right foot placement a little more laterally.  Turns out that my right foot has been landing too close to the midline, and has been contributing to some of my recent injuries.
